MG2 is seeking a talented Mixed-Use Project Designer to join our Seattle office in our Community Environments Market!
- Trains staff effectively into their assigned roles
- Handles Quality Control of project documents (internal team review)
- Displays confidence when presenting and representing projects
- Collaborates successfully with project team members
- Owns responsibility of maintaining design intent during technical development phases of projects
- Develops technical solutions based on design directions
- Adheres to project work plan, budget, scope, and schedule
- Assist with master planning, concept, schematic and design development documents and drawings, construction documents
- Work with project design team, including consultants
- Participates in client communication
- Produces well-organized and well-coordinated work
- Meets technical requirements for constructability and code compliance in documents
- Support project design intent and goals for successful implementation
- Implements sustainability related goals of the project during design phases
- Assist with design presentations for clients and government authorities
- Experience in multi-family and/or mixed-use design with experience in shell and core design
- Demonstrated understanding of all aspects of design and construction document phases
- Bachelor of Architecture
- Well-rounded knowledge base
- Exhibits MG2 Practice Values of Integrated Approach, Design Excellence, Social Responsibility, Leadership, and Results.
- LEED AP or equivalent, preferred
- Demonstrated ability to deliver design solutions
- Strong understanding of design ordinances
- Strong proficiency in Revit, Lumion/Enscape, Photoshop, InDesign, Illustrator, Rhino
- Basic understanding of constructability
- 5+ years of architectural design experience
- Has volunteered or participated in community or professional organization events
- Licensed or certified professional, preferred
- Participation in a 401K program including eligible company match percentage, after waiting period
- Learning & Career Development opportunities
- Employer sponsored Family Planning Program and employer Paid Parental Leave
- Paid Time Off, 9 paid Holidays, and an additional Floating Holiday
- Employer provided employee healthcare plan and reduced cost premium plans, life insurance, and short and long-term disability coverage
- Employee Wellness and Employee Assistance Program
- Associate 4 (Minimum 8 years of Architecture experience, domestic experience preferred): $78,100 - $134,900
- Associate 3 (Minimum 5 years of Architecture experience, domestic experience preferred): $66,000 - $100,100
